What is an example of how a Power of Attorney impact a nurses care with a patient?​
san4es73 [151]
The power of attorney is usually decide upon by the patient in advance. The power of attorney has the right to make medical decisions for the patient if the patient is incapable of making decisions for themselves due to illness or disease progression such as dementia or Alzheimer’s.
